Author Title Description
Kevin Henkes Olive's Ocean Martha prepares for the summer vacation to Cape Cod and learns more about herself, her family and her shy classmate.
Christopher Paolini Eragon (Inheritance, Book 1) Eragon is a wonderful fantasy of a dragon that hatches from a beautiful stone that begins a quest adventure.
Andrew Clements The Report Card Nora is getting poor grades, but it's all a trick because she's really a genius.
Cornelia Funke Inkheart When Meggie's father, Mo, reads aloud, he brings the characters to life--literally.
Jeanne Duprau City of Ember An underground city lives without light until two brave children try to escape and find the secret of Ember.
Stephen M. Tomecek What a Great Idea!:  Inventions That Changed the World Profiles forty-five historic and prehistoric inventions, explaining how they work and describing their origins and impact. Includes such developments as the hand ax, the axle, writing, money, the clock, anesthesia, and the nuclear reactor.
Avi Crispin: The Cross of Lead Falsely accused of theft and murder, an orphaned peasant boy in fourteenth-century England flees his village and meets a larger-than-life juggler who holds a dangerous secret.
Carl Hiaasen Hoot Roy, who is new to his small Florida community, becomes involved in another boy's attempt to save a colony of burrowing owls from a proposed construction site.
Jerry Spinelli Loser Even though his classmates from first grade on have considered him strange and a loser, Daniel Zinkoff's optimism and exuberance and the support of his loving family do not allow him to feel that way about himself.
Michael Chabon Summerland Ethan Feld, the worst baseball player in the history of the game, finds himself recruited by a 100-year-old scout to help a band of fairies triumph over an ancient enemy.
Stephanie S. Tolan Surviving the Applewhites Jake, a budding juvenile delinquent, is sent for home schooling to the arty and eccentric Applewhite family's Creative Academy, where he discovers talents and interests he never knew he had.
